In 2021, Mason, age 35 and single, earned wages of $76,000. Mason had exclusions of $1,000, and he had adjustments of $1,000. Masons itemized deductions for the year totaled $12,000. Mason is not entitled to any qualified business income deduction. Mason's employer withheld federal income taxes of $5,000 from Mason's paychecks, and Mason is also entitled to an additional $2,500 tax credit. What is Mason's gross income? What is Mason's adjusted gross income? What is Mason's taxable income? Using the 2021 tax rate schedules, what is Mason's tax liability (before credits and withholdings)? Using the tax tables, what is Mason's tax liability (before credits and withholdings)? Which option does Mason use? How do the withholding and tax credits impact Mason's tax liability?
